Your impact Leonardo UK operates in a complex security, regulatory and defence environment.
As a Governance, Risk and Compliance Analyst, you will support the Information Security team in maintaining clear standards, assessing risk and providing assurance that security controls are understood, evidenced and reviewed across the business.
The role will work across multiple business areas and may require travel between Leonardo UK sites, with hybrid working supported where appropriate.
What you will do as Governance, Risk and Compliance Analyst
- Support the Head of Governance, Risk and Compliance with the day-to-day information security governance, risk and compliance workload.
- Assist with maintaining security standards, control mappings and assurance processes.
- Support reviews of security management and assurance plans to help ensure controls are properly described, evidenced and aligned to the agreed standard.
- Conduct or support risk assessments where security controls are not implemented, including documenting the risk position and supporting appropriate review.
- Conduct audit and assurance activity across Leonardo UK systems and services.
- Help track non-compliances, remediation activity and risk acceptance decisions.
- Work with delivery teams, system owners and security specialists to gather evidence and support proportionate security governance.
- Contribute to compliance, risk and assurance reporting for the Information Security function.
- Support continual improvement of the Information Security Operating Model, including better use of data, tooling and automation.

Security Clearance
This role is subject to pre-employment screening in line with the UK Government’s Baseline Personnel Security Standard (BPSS).
An additional range of Personnel Security Controls referred to as National Security Vetting (NSV) may apply, this could include meeting the eligibility requirements for The Security Check (SC) or Developed Vetting (DV).

Leonardo UK operates a grade-based salary framework with broad bands.
The salary range shown reflects the approved grade band for this role, or a narrower hiring range published within that band, and is benchmarked against the external market.
Exceptions above the standard range are managed through governance controls to protect internal equity.
